SUMMARY:Using Health Impact Assessments to Preserve Affordable Housing & Increase Community Wellbeing: A Case Study
DESCRIPTION:A public health professional\, a housing authority director and a funder discussed how a Health Impact Assessment moved a Phoenix public housing rehab project from business-as-usual to an inclusive process that engages a neighborhood and charts a sustainable future for the residents. \n \nAbout the Presenters\nGloria Munoz\, Director\nHousing Authority of Maricopa County \nJane Pearson\, B.S.N.\nHIA Consultant for LISC Phoenix \nTeresa Brice\, Executive Director\nLISC Phoenix \nOther Resources\nCOFFELT-LAMOREAUX PUBLIC HOUSING REDEVELOPMENT Health Impact Assessment Report \nWebinar Sponsored By:
